🗣️ An English Game That Moves When You Speak
Shout "Jump!" and the character will jump.
It is not a game where you press buttons; it is a runner game where the child must speak English themselves to move forward.
🌍 World Tour: 20 Countries
Starting from Seoul, travel to Tokyo, London, Paris, Egypt, Kenya, and Sydney.
Pass through different backgrounds and landmarks in each country, encountering new words and sentences.
🎯 What You Should Know
- Speaking Practice Becomes a Game
Learning isn't just about listening; it progresses only when you speak out loud.
It's okay to make mistakes. You are given another chance to speak.
- Works Without Internet
Voice recognition is processed within the mobile phone, so it works even on airplanes or subways.
- Your Voice Does Not Be Emitted
The child's voice is processed only within the device and is not transmitted to or stored on a server.
- Beginner Helper
It displays the Korean pronunciation and meaning together, allowing even beginners to follow along.
